You can see the Petronas Twin Towers from almost everywhere in Kuala Lumpur — but standing at their base is something else entirely. For eleven years the tallest buildings in the world, they remain among the most breathtaking structures ever built. The skybridge, the views, the sheer ambition of them.
Below ground, the KLCC Aquaria offers a completely different kind of wonder — one of Southeast Asia's finest aquariums, where sharks glide overhead and thousands of species move through carefully constructed ecosystems. Peaceful, extraordinary, and unlike anything you'll find at home.

The morning takes you to Batu Caves — a series of Hindu temple caves built into a limestone hill that predates the city by millions of years. 272 steps lead you up past the towering golden statue of Lord Murugan into caverns where worship and wonder exist in the same breath.
Then, elevation. Genting Highlands sits 1,800 metres above sea level in the clouds above KL — a mountain resort that feels like a different country entirely. Cool air, sweeping views over the jungle canopy, and lunch served high above the city you came from.

Your half-day city tour moves through the colonial heart of Singapore, past the Merlion, through the ethnic quarters of Chinatown and Little India, and along the waterfront where old trading houses have become world-class restaurants.
Then, the Singapore Flyer — one of the world's largest observation wheels, lifting you 165 metres above the city for panoramic views that take in Malaysia on the horizon and the South China Sea beyond.
As evening falls, the Marina Bay Sands SkyPark delivers the defining image of modern Singapore — the infinity pool perched on the 57th floor, the city blazing below, and the light show over the bay beginning precisely on time. Because this is Singapore.
